What does an entry level screen printer do?

An entry level screen printer assists in the process of printing designs onto various materials, such as t-shirts, posters, or signs, using a screen printing press. Typical duties include preparing screens and inks, setting up and operating the printing equipment, aligning materials for accurate prints, and cleaning screens and work areas after use. They may also help with quality control by inspecting finished products for errors and assisting more experienced printers as needed.

What are some typical challenges faced by entry level screen printers, and how can they be overcome?

Entry level screen printers often encounter challenges such as mastering precise ink application, maintaining consistent print quality, and efficiently setting up screens for different projects. These tasks can be demanding at first, but attention to detail and adherence to established procedures help improve results over time. Working closely with experienced team members and seeking feedback can accelerate skill development. As you gain experience, you’ll become more comfortable troubleshooting issues and managing production timelines.

Main Functions

We are seeking an energetic and detail-oriented Thick Film Printer Technician - Level 1 to join our growing technical manufacturing team. In this entry-level role, you will work closely with senior technicians and production staff to perform routine printer operations, material staging, and basic preventative maintenance tasks.

This is a hands-on opportunity to build your technical skills in precision screen printing, support daily manufacturing output, and contribute to a clean, safe, and efficient production environment.


Key Responsibilities  

  • Routine Operation & Staging: Assist with basic machine loading, substrate staging, and operating semi-automated thick film screen printers under direct supervision.
  • Material Preparation & Handling: Prepare, mix, and stage conductive/resistive Inks following strict recipes; assist with screen cleaning, reclamation, and proper storage.
  • Basic Inspection & Quality Support: Perform visual inspections of printed substrates under magnification to check for obvious flaws, smearing, or misalignments, reporting defects immediatelyt o senior staff.
  • Preventative Maintenance & Support: Perform scheduled basic housekeeping and routine preventative maintenance tasks on printing platforms and cleanroom equipment.
  • Documentation & Yield Tracking: Accurately log production counts, lot numbers, traveler sign-offs, and scrap data into the manufacturing execution system (MES) or ERP platform.
  • Continuous Improvement & S: Participate in plant 5S, cleanroom housekeeping, and Lean manufacturing initiatives to keep the print area organized, safe, and contamination-free.
  • Safety & Compliance: Strictly comply with all safety rules, chemical handling guidelines, ESD (electrostatic discharge) protocols, cleanroom regulations, and proper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) usage.
